What Is Multiple Sclerosis?

Multiple sclerosis (MS) is an autoimmune disorder where the body’s immune system attacks its own nerve cells. It affects more than 2 million people worldwide, with varying levels of severity depending on the individual. Symptoms include muscle weakness, pain, fatigue, vision problems, and balance issues. As there is no cure for MS yet, treatment focuses on managing existing symptoms and preventing further damage to nerves and muscles.

What Are Cannabinoids?

Cannabinoids are compounds found naturally in the cannabis plant that interact with receptors in our endocannabinoid system (ECS). This unique system plays a role in many physiological processes including inflammation response and mood regulation – making it a potential target for helping people who live with chronic conditions like MS.
